How safe is Murton?
Murton has a very low crime rate of 28.6 crimes per 1,000 people, making it one of the safest areas. Crime hotspots have been reported near Supermarket, as reported by South Wales Police.
What are the demographics of Murton?
The majority of residents in Murton identify as White (British) (94%). Most residents were born in the United Kingdom (95%). The most common religion is Christian (52%).
